AI Findings Summary
The telemetry indicates a significant exposure event involving 21 historical data breaches affecting employees of norfolksouthern.com. These breaches, primarily originating from database dumps, occurred between July 2025 and June 2026, with a notable concentration in January 2026 where 18 employee-related incidents were recorded. The lack of client or infostealer-related events suggests the impact is largely internal. Given the volume of historical data breaches and their direct impact on employees, this exposure warrants a high-priority review. The focus should be on understanding the nature of the compromised data within the database dumps, assessing the potential for further compromise or misuse of employee information, and implementing robust data security measures to prevent recurrence. Prioritizing the remediation of vulnerabilities that led to these database dump exposures is crucial.
